here are some problems with a fast 305:
the bore sucks on a 305
you cannot run large valves on a 305
stroking a 305 means you are taking an engine with an already not big enough bore and giving it an even longer stroke. The 9 second 305 car everyone worships isnt even a real 305, its a 4" bore motor.
